Nicky Nichols, an owner of Redman, said the parish stands to receive
$150,000 a year in sales taxes and $500,000 for its share of
gambling
revenue from the truck stop, which would have 40 video poker
machines and
employ 50 to 60 people.

"There's no economic growth down there whatsoever. Nothing is
happening,"
Nichols said. "This project could really get things going."
